Carrier Furnace Fault Code 41

House Heating Unit Repair by Professional Technician, Carrier Furnace Fault Code 41 - What Is Wrong?

Malfunctioning of one's device often occurs to everyone. So, it is essential to know why it failed. Below are the causes of the frequently occurring error code 41 in Carrier furnaces:

1. Dead Blower Motor

Your blower motor may be damaged when operating outside the acceptable speed range. Remember that the blower motor speed cannot be kept constant for 30 seconds within 10% of the estimated rate. This error also means that the blower either failed to attain 250 RPM.

How To Fix Carrier Furnace Fault Code 41

How To Fix Carrier Furnace Fault Code 41 - Male technician hands using a screwdriver fixing modern air conditioner, repairing and servicing,

The good news is that Carrier furnace fault code 41 has straightforward solutions. The first is to examine the status of your LED. If you confirm that the status code is 41, the motor control system has determined that the motor has been slowed to below 250 rpm for more than 10 seconds after reaching speed or that the engine will not get speed within 30 seconds of being instructed to run.

You may also check to see if electricity is getting to the engine. If it does, but the motor isn't operating, it probably failed. The best option here is to replace them.

Remember that if the fan coil control and motor wire harness work correctly, do not replace them. Next is to verify that the blower wheel isn't rubbing against the housing. The blower must rotate easily and not create a lot of noise.

How To Read A Carrier Furnace Code

Your furnace is having trouble when it starts to blink. The codes assist you in identifying the problem and fixing it before it leads to more severe issues.

The first digit of the two-digit Carrier furnace fault code represents the number of flashes the yellow light makes. The second digit is determined by the green light LED.

If your Carrier furnace is locked in high-fire mode, the flashing yellow light will appear as an error signal. A broken gas valve solenoid can cause a furnace to become stuck in the high fire setting. The furnace is stuck in the low fire mode when the green LED light blinks continuously.
